Rebase and push
WebbWith ask (implied by --interactive ), the rebase will halt when an empty commit is applied allowing you to choose whether to drop it, edit files more, or just commit the empty changes. Other options, like --exec, will use the default of drop unless -i / --interactive is explicitly specified. WebbIn case you had pushed your branch to remote repository (usually it's origin) and then you've done a succesfull rebase ... This is a very clean solution. Thank you for posting. I …
Rebase and push
Did you know?
Webb14 apr. 2024 · How to do a git rebase. switch to the branch pr with your changes. locally set your git repo to the branch that has the changes you want merged in the target branch. execute the git rebase command. run git rebase i origin master if you want to do it interactively and your changes need to go in master. Webb8 sep. 2016 · To interactively rebase commits, we can follow the below format and enter our command via the command line: git rebase -i HEAD~ or git rebase -i The ‘ -i ’ flag in...
WebbThis guide helps you to get started with rebases, force pushes, and fixing merge conflicts locally. Before you attempt a force push or a rebase, make sure you are familiar with Git … Windows - Git rebase and force push GitLab Advanced Config - Git rebase and force push GitLab VirtualBox - Git rebase and force push GitLab GitLab 15.10 released with the ability to automatically resolve SAST findings … GitLab Runner - Git rebase and force push GitLab Sidekiq MemoryKiller - Git rebase and force push GitLab Enforce Two-Factor Authentication - Git rebase and force push GitLab Encrypted Configuration - Git rebase and force push GitLab Webbgit rebase master will rebase the current branch onto the local master. Pushing deals with a remote branch. It sounds like your local master isn't up to date with the state of the remote; that needs to get fixed before your rebase will have the apparently-intended effect. It is unclear what DEI-2731 is.
Webb27 mars 2024 · The git rebase command is, essentially, just a series of git cherry-pick commands followed by a branch label motion. As you've already discovered, git cherry … WebbRebasing is a great tool, but it works best when you use it to create fast-forward merges for topic branches onto master. For example, you might rebase your add-new-widget branch …
Webb8 aug. 2024 · You can look at the git documentation, if you want to know more about git rebase command. The key is the interactive mode ( -i ), that allows you to edit the commits which are being rebased. At this point, …
WebbIf you rebase commits that have already been pushed publicly, and people may have based work on those commits, then you may be in for some frustrating trouble, and the scorn … lp that\\u0027llWebbIf somebody else built on top of your original history while you are rebasing, the tip of the branch at the remote may advance with their commit, and blindly pushing with --force will lose their work. This option allows you to say that you expect the history you are updating is what you rebased and want to replace. lpt education and training centreWebb回滚场景:已 push 到远端时. 注意!. 此时不能用 "git reset",需要用 "git revert"!. 重要事情说三遍!. 之所以这样强调,是因为 "git reset" 会抹掉历史,用在已经 push 的记录上会 … lp tech placageWebbIf another user has rebased and force pushed to the branch that you’re committing to, a git pull will then overwrite any commits you have based off that previous branch with the tip … lp that\\u0027dWebb23 aug. 2016 · Rebasing a commit produces another commit that has the same content as the original commit but a different ID. Given the original commit was pushed and you forcibly push the new commit, the other … lpt flightsWebb20 okt. 2016 · As explained above, when you do a rebase, you are changing the history on your branch. As a result, if you try to do a normal git push after a rebase, Git will reject it because there isn't a direct path from the commit on … lp th17 cellsWebb20 jan. 2012 · Don't rebase public history. As we've discussed previously in rewriting history, you should never rebase commits once they've been pushed to a public … lp thalamus